Schurrle hints at Premier League return

Tottenham Hotspur and Liverpool target Andre Schurrle has hinted that he could leave Wolfsburg during the summer transfer window. The German international has had a tough time at the Bundesliga outfit this season.
Schurrle, 25, joined the Wolves from Chelsea at the start of 2015 with a view to firming a regular role in the starting setup.
However, things have not gone as to plan since then with manager Dieter Hecking opting to play the likes of Max Kruse and Bas Dost ahead of him in many of the games.
"I think it's just too early. I'll prepare now for the European Championships," he told German daily Bild.
"I'll try to play with Germany a very good tournament, to give everything. Then we'll see."
Schurrle made just 21 league starts in the 2015-16 league campaign.
